Mark Shepherd interviews Dr. Jessica Feda, a PT in the US Public Health Services, serving in the federal prison system. PTs serving in the federal prison system have access to a unique set of patients.

Listen in as Jessica walks you through her service as a PT in the federal prison system. From chronic pain management to a wheelchair seating program, she acts as a direct access healthcare provider for inmates at every security level.
